Understanding MIT OpenCourseWare
At the heart of MIT's free online offerings is OpenCourseWare, a digital publication of virtually all MIT course content. Unlike a traditional online degree program, OCW does not provide accreditation, certificates, or direct interaction with faculty for grader feedback. Instead, it provides the raw materials of an MIT education: syllabi, lecture notes, assignments, exams, and reading lists. This structure empowers learners to self-direct their educational journey, acting as architects of their own knowledge construction rather than passive recipients of instruction.

How to Navigate the Platform Accessing MIT OpenCourseWare is straightforward, requiring only a visit to the OCW website. The interface is designed for exploration, featuring a robust search function that allows users to filter courses by department, topic, or availability. Users can browse individual courses to find specific lectures or download entire sets of materials. The site is organized to facilitate deep dives, allowing learners to follow a logical progression of lectures and assignments just as they would in a physical classroom. Complementary Learning Resources Beyond the core OCW library, MIT provides a variety of supplementary resources to enhance the learning experience. The MIT Open Learning Library offers select courses in an interactive format, providing immediate feedback through auto-graded assessments. Additionally, platforms like MITx on edX allow learners to audit courses for free or pursue verified certificates for a fee, offering a more structured experience with scheduled sessions and community engagement features.
